Jaime Harrison opens up about the pressures of being a Black Democrat in South Carolina.
On Election Day 2020, U.S. Senate candidate, Jaime Harrison, opens up about himself and the pressures of being a Black Democrat in South Carolina. He also answers questions from reporters about what he would do for the people on his first day if he wins.
